hey guys i was going for one of my first rides of the season the other day and i was just getting started and for some reason it started jerking like it was running out of gas but i looked down and there was gas in the tank  :dunno_white: then it just shut off i was able to get to the side of the road and then it wouldnt start back up but after a second of letting it sit it just started right back up like it was nothing  :cookoo: whats wrong?

beRto

Either you're out of gas or there's a problem with the vacuum petcock (fuel valve on the fram).

I would try the following:
1) Fill up the gas tank (an "empty" tank still has lots of fuel in it). If that works, great... problem solved!
2) If #1 doesn't work, run the bike on the PRI position to bypass the vacuum. If that works, the petcock will need to be replaced (common problem on GS; search for "fuel starvation")

Good luck! And keep us posted.  :thumb:

What year is the bike?

I recently bought a '95 with 3000 miles on it that had the same problem. Turns out the rubber inside the petcock had gotten old and I was having fuel starvation problems. A new petcock fixed that right up!

I'd try filling the gas tank first.  :thumb:
